In just 21 months, a single site in the Netherlands became a recycling titan, processing a staggering 7.5 million container: a volume so massive it would bury a standard supermarket machine.


Customers are now bypassing traditional stores and flocking to Bungas in Bunschoten-Spakenburg, drawn by the "Quantum" machine that swallows entire bags of bottles and cans in seconds without a single sticky touch.


The demand was so relentless that the owner had no choice but to install a second unit just to keep the flow moving 24/7. But as millions of containers continue to pour in and the lines for traditional recycling grow longer elsewhere, one question remains.
